قَالَ قَ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 إِنَّ بَيْنَ أَيْدِيكُمْ فِتَنًا كَقِطَعِ اللَّيْلِ الْمُظْلِمِ يُصْبِحُ الرَّجُلُ فِيهَا مُؤْمِنًا وَيُمْسِي كَافِرًا وَيُمْسِي مُؤْمِنًا وَيُصْبِحُ كَافِرًا الْقَاعِدُ فِيهَا خَيْرٌ مِنْ الْقَائِمِ وَالْقَائِمُ فِيهَا خَيْرٌ مِنْ الْمَاشِي وَالْمَاشِي فِيهَا خَيْرٌ مِنْ السَّاعِي قَالُوا فَمَا تَأْمُرُنَا قَالَ كُونُوا أَحْلَاسَ بُيُوتِكُمْ.

He said: The Messenger of Allah, peace and blessings be upon him, said: "Ahead of you there are trials like pieces of a dark night; a man will awaken a believer and become an unbeliever by evening, or awaken an unbeliever and become a believer by evening. The one sitting during them is better than the one standing, and the one standing is better than the one walking, and the one walking is better than the one running." They said, "What do you command us to do?" He said, "Be like the mats of your houses."
